Richard Levey of Shareware Enterprises in Elmont, NY, and J.J. Webb of Lockheed have both submitted copies of a program that they thought was identical to VIRUSCAN version 19 in the way it operated. On analysis, the program turned out to be Viruscan V19 with a number of modifications. No attempt was made to modify the VIRUSCAN program messages, internal data strings or instruction sequences, with the single exception of the copyright notice. The copyright notice was changed to 'Copyright 1989, WileySoft Corporation". The only modification made to the documentation was the change of name and address to: WileySoft 11 Trafalgar Square Nashua, NH 03063 And a request to send $24 to the above address was added. The program was then compressed, a front end loader/decompressor was tacked on, and the final package was infected with what appears to be a modified version of the Jerusalem virus. The final EXE file was named SCAN (the same as the VIRUSCAN executable module) and was 22917 bytes long. A check with the local Nashua phone company found no listing for such a company, and no WileySoft Corporation was registered in the state of New Hampshire. VIRUSCAN users should be aware of this trojan program. Please check that your executable module is exactly 34400 bytes long. All versions of VIRUSCAN have been this length and all future versions are planned to have the same length. Ensure that the McAfee Associates copyright is displayed with the version ID and phone number in the first display line. If there are any questions about the validity of your program, an original copy may be downloaded from HomeBase, 408 988 4004, from SIMTEL20 or some other reliable source. John McAfee ..-....
